If the system of linear equations given by x + y + z = 3 , 2 x + 2 y - z = 3 , x + y - z = 1 is consistent and if x 0 , y 0 , z 0 is a solution, then 2 x 0 + 2 y 0 + z 0 =
Options
- A0
- B5
- C7
- D6
Correct answer
B. 5
Step-by-step solution
Given, x + y + z = 3       . . . i 2 x + 2 y - z = 3     . . . i i x + y - z = 1     . . . i i i Adding, we get x + y = 2     . . . i v Substituting this value of x + y in i , we get z = 1 Now, if x 0 , y 0 , z 0 is the solution then x 0 + y 0 = 2   &   z 0 = 1 . Then, 2 x 0 + 2 y 0 + z 0 = 2 x 0 + y 0 + z 0 = 2 × 2 + 1 = 5 .
